Isle of Dogs, London E14, UK

A photo taken by Martin Pearce at the location London Borough of Tower Hamlets with coordinates [51.499769, -0.020918]. Additionally, you might be interested in finding other photos captured by different users near London Borough of Tower Hamlets. Both sets of images could provide a richer perspective of the area and showcase various moments in time.

Isle of Dogs, London E14, UK by Martin Pearce
Near Photos

Near Photos of London Borough of Tower Hamlets at [51.499769, -0.020918]

Martin Pearce's Other Photos

Other photos taken by Martin Pearce